Governor Hutchinson 5/4/2021 COVID Press Conference
https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=xelhtdViODE
> This is the last weekly COVID update. There will still be a weekly new update from the office, but it won’t be all COVID based.
> Case report: 336,462 total cases, an increase of 296 from yesterday.
> Total active cases: 2,043, an increase of 104 since yesterday.
> 5,752 total deaths due to COVID, an increase of 5 since yesterday.
> 192 currently hospitalized, up 20 from yesterday.
> Top counties: Benton 43, Washington 42, Pulaski 27
> Testing remains low- 6,022 PCR tests (this month to date), only 1,840 PCR tests yesterday; 1,937 antigen tests to date this month, only 1,079 yesterday.
> Nearly 11,000 vaccinations were given out yesterday.
> Total vaccination doses received= 2,525,070 and have given 1,751,620 vaccinations to date. That is 69.4% of doses given.
> Individuals partially immunized= 270,426
> Individuals full immunized= 768,130
> The Governor is challenging Arkansas residents to reach a vaccination goal of 50% of Arkansans with at least one shot in the next 90 days. Currently 1,038,556 or 34% have received at least one shot. 467,206 more Arkansans will need to receive a shot to reach this goal.
> Benton County needs 19.5% of residents to receive at least one dose of the COVID vaccine to get to that 50% vaccination level.
> Pop up vaccination clinics will be occurring throughout the state. ADH will now be taking the vaccine to the local events where anyone who wants to get a shot. No appointment needed; no specific time needed. ADH is bringing vaccines to local events.
> The current state of emergency will end May 30, 2021.
> Variants have been detected in more than double the number of counties since 4/3/21.
> If you are traveling to/from India, please quarantine 14 days upon return to Arkansas.
>Children really have no protection against the virus unless those around them are vaccinated. Please consider how this will protect your children when getting the vaccine.
